The assessment of biodiversity of scorpion fauna at district Karak, Khyber Pakhtunkhwa (KP), Pakistan

Abstract


Scorpions are venomous arthropods belonging to the order Scorpions and class Arachnida. Scorpions have evolved to live in a wide range of environments, such as caves, savanna, tropical forests, rain forests, grasslands, temperate forests, and even snow-capped mountains. The purpose of this study was to create an identification key for the species and investigate the diversity of scorpion fauna in District Karak, Khyber Pakhtunkhwa (KP), Pakistan.Study was conducted between September 2023 and September 2024 and a total number of 40 specimens were collected randomly from Sabirabad, Methakhel, Hamidan, and Karak city. Androctonus finitimus, Hottentotta tamulus, and A. balochicus were identified as 37.5%, 35% and 27.5%, respectively. Results of the current study revealed that all of them belonged to family Buthidae. Morphometric and pectinal teeth variations were observed, suggesting the possibility of subspecies diversity or the existence of unrecorded species. The findings reveal a relatively low diversity of scorpion species in Karak compared to other regions and underscore the need for further ecological and taxonomic investigations. This research provides a foundational understanding of the scorpion biodiversity in southern KP, establishing a critical framework for future biodiversity assessments and conservation strategies
